    citronic used to make bits of kit just like that, i have seen a few at various record fairs, but they're all belt drive....

    keeping to the 70's theme, as an avid record collector a few years ago i also picked up a Technics SL1200 mark one of the same vintage, before the addition of the pitch slider and stop start buttons of the MK2. i'll post pics if anyones interested
